First Orapex in three years ‘a complete success’
Canada’s first in-person national show since October 2019 went ahead to hearty applause this April as a recently reformed organizational structure found success at a new venue. Reorganized last year as an Ontario not-for-profit corporation known as the Ottawa Regional Association of Stamp Exhibitions – or Orapex – the group hosted its first event on April 23-24; however, it was the show’s 59th outing since 1961. The new venue, a heated curling rink at the Nepean Sportsplex, held about 30 dealers and nearly 170 exhibit frames while drawing praise from many show-goers. “If compliments testify to the strength of the show, it was a complete success,” said show chair John Tooth, a former president of the Ottawa Philatelic Society (OPS), one of the three main clubs whose members organize the annual show. “We have received thanks related to the exhibits and the bourse from a wide range of attendees, including dealers, philatelists and exhibitors.” Continue reading →
